The shift toward integration began in the late 20th century as research conclusively demonstrated that stress, fear, and anxiety directly impact an animal's immune system, healing rates, and overall longevity. Today, veterinary behavior is a recognized specialty, with organizations like the American College of Veterinary Behaviorists (ACVB) certifying specialists who treat complex behavioral disorders using a combination of behavior modification and psychopharmacology. One of the most impactful applications of behavioral science in veterinary medicine is the widespread adoption of "Fear-Free" and low-stress handling methodologies. Standard veterinary visits have traditionally been highly stressful for animals, involving forceful restraint, unfamiliar odors, and frightening sounds.
